数字人客服技术预研:架构设计与关键实现路径

一、数字人客服技术概述

数字人客服是人工智能技术与计算机图形学深度融合的产物,通过自然语言处理(NLP)、语音合成(TTS)、计算机视觉(CV)等技术,实现拟人化的交互体验。其核心价值在于:

  1. 7×24小时无间断服务:突破人力客服的时间限制,提升响应效率;
  2. 多模态交互能力:支持文本、语音、表情、动作的同步输出,增强用户沉浸感;
  3. 低成本规模化部署:单模型可服务海量用户,边际成本趋近于零。

当前行业常见技术方案多采用“NLP引擎+3D渲染引擎+语音交互模块”的架构,但存在语音识别延迟高、唇形同步误差大、上下文理解能力弱等痛点。本文将从技术预研角度,拆解关键模块的实现路径。

二、技术架构设计:分层解耦与模块化

1. 分层架构设计

建议采用四层架构(如图1所示):

  • 接入层:负责多渠道协议适配(Web、APP、小程序等),支持HTTP/WebSocket/gRPC协议;
  • 对话管理层:包含意图识别、对话状态跟踪(DST)、对话策略生成(DP)模块;
  • 数字人渲染层:集成3D建模、骨骼动画、唇形同步算法;
  • 数据层:存储用户画像、对话日志、知识库等结构化/非结构化数据。
  1. # 示例:对话管理层的简单状态机实现
  2. class DialogManager:
  3. def __init__(self):
  4. self.state = "INIT" # 初始状态
  5. self.context = {} # 对话上下文
  6. def process_input(self, user_input):
  7. if self.state == "INIT":
  8. self.state = "GREETING"
  9. return self._generate_greeting()
  10. elif self.state == "QUESTION_ASKED":
  11. answer = self._query_knowledge_base(user_input)
  12. self.state = "ANSWER_PROVIDED"
  13. return answer
  14. # 其他状态处理...

2. 关键模块解耦

  • NLP引擎:需支持多轮对话、实体抽取、情感分析,推荐基于Transformer的预训练模型(如BERT、GPT);
  • 语音交互模块:需优化ASR(语音转文本)的实时性(建议延迟<300ms)和TTS的自然度(推荐参数化语音合成);
  • 3D渲染引擎:需支持轻量化模型(如GLTF格式)和实时动作驱动(如通过BLEP算法优化唇形同步)。

三、核心模块实现与优化

1. 自然语言处理(NLP)

  • 意图识别:采用BiLSTM+CRF模型,结合领域知识库提升准确率。例如,在电商场景中,需识别“退换货”“优惠券”等高频意图。
  • 对话管理:使用强化学习(RL)优化对话策略,例如通过Q-learning调整回复的详细程度。
  • 知识库集成:支持向量数据库(如Milvus)实现语义检索,解决传统关键词匹配的召回率低问题。

2. 多模态交互同步

  • 唇形同步:基于McLennan-Parker算法,通过音素-视素映射表驱动3D模型嘴部动作,误差需控制在50ms内。
  • 表情与动作生成:采用GAN生成动态表情,结合规则引擎触发特定动作(如点头表示确认)。
  • 语音情感适配:通过声纹分析识别用户情绪(如愤怒、开心),动态调整数字人语气。

3. 性能优化策略

  • 模型轻量化:使用TensorFlow Lite或ONNX Runtime部署NLP模型,减少内存占用(建议<200MB);
  • 渲染优化:采用LOD(Level of Detail)技术,根据设备性能动态调整模型精度;
  • 并发处理:通过Kubernetes集群实现水平扩展,支持每秒1000+并发请求。

四、最佳实践与注意事项

1. 开发阶段建议

  • 数据准备:收集10万+条对话数据用于NLP模型微调,标注需包含意图、实体、情感标签;
  • 工具链选择:推荐使用Unity(3D渲染)+PyTorch(NLP)+WebRTC(实时通信)的组合;
  • 测试策略:通过A/B测试对比不同回复策略的用户满意度(CSAT)。

2. 部署与运维

  • 边缘计算:在CDN节点部署轻量化模型,降低中心服务器压力;
  • 监控体系:建立Prometheus+Grafana监控面板,实时跟踪响应延迟、错误率等指标;
  • 热更新机制:支持知识库和对话策略的无缝更新,避免服务中断。

3. 伦理与合规

  • 隐私保护:遵循GDPR等法规,对用户对话数据进行脱敏处理;
  • 内容过滤:集成敏感词检测模块,防止不当言论输出;
  • 透明度声明:在交互界面明确告知用户“当前为AI客服”。

五、未来技术演进方向

  1. 大模型融合:引入千亿参数语言模型,提升复杂问题处理能力;
  2. 全息投影:结合AR/VR技术,实现数字人客服的物理空间投影;
  3. 自主进化:通过联邦学习实现模型在多客户端的协同优化。

数字人客服技术的预研需兼顾技术深度与工程可行性。开发者应优先解决NLP准确性、多模态同步等核心问题,同时通过模块化设计降低系统复杂度。未来,随着大模型和实时渲染技术的突破,数字人客服将向“超拟人化”“情感化”方向演进,成为企业数字化转型的关键基础设施。